Read moreจากประสบการณ์ตรง การอ่านหนังสือให้มีประสิทธิภาพไม่ได้ขึ้นอยู่กับเวลาเพียงอย่างเดียว แต่ยังรวมถึงการเตรียมสภาพแวดล้อมและตัวเองด้วย เช่น การเลือกจุดที่เงียบสงบและสบายใจ เพื่อช่วยให้สมาธิไม่ฟุ้งซ่าน สิ่งนี้ทำให้ผมสามารถจดจ่อกับเนื้อหาได้ดียิ่งขึ้น อีกเทคนิคที่อยากแนะนำคือการใช้วิธี Pomodoro หรือแบ่งเวลาอ่านเป็นช่วงๆ เช่น อ่าน 25 นาที แล้วพัก 5 นาที ทำซ้ำ 4 รอบ จากนั้นพักยาว 15-30 นาที การทำแบบนี้ช่วยให้สมองไม่ล้าและรักษาความตื่นตัวได้ดีมากขึ้น ตัวผมเองทดลองใช้แล้วพบว่าการอ่านและทำความเข้าใจเนื้อหายุ่งยากกลายเป็นเรื่องง่ายขึ้น นอกจากนี้ การเลือกเวลาที่สมองทำงานได้ดีที่สุด (Prime Time) ของตัวเอง เป็นเรื่องสำคัญมาก ผมสังเกตว่าถ้าอ่านในช่วงเวลาที่ร่างกายตื่นตัว เช่น เช้าหรือก่อนเที่ยง ประสิทธิภาพในการอ่านจะดีและจดจำได้นานกว่า เรื่องของการเติมพลังงานก็ช่วยได้มาก เช่น ดื่มชา หรือกาแฟในปริมาณที่เหมาะสม แต่ต้องระวังไม่ให้มากเกินไปจนเกิดอาการง่วงซึมหรือกระสับกระส่าย และอย่าลืมดื่มน้ำเปล่าให้เพียงพอ เพราะสมองที่ขาดน้ำจะทำให้ความจำและสมาธิลดลงอย่างเห็นได้ชัด สุดท้าย การรู้จักฟังสัญญาณของร่างกายว่าถึงเวลาพักหรือยังก็เป็นสิ่งจำเป็น บางครั้งเมื่อรู้สึกง่วงหรือสมองล้า การหยุดพักสั้นๆ หรืองีบ 10-15 นาที จะช่วยให้กลับมาอ่านต่อได้อย่างมีประสิทธิภาพมากขึ้นกว่าเดิมแน่นอน
